Product detailed description
- neutralising filter for condensing boilers with output up to 35 kW
- material: Nylon 12 container, filter for the neutralising filling made of stainless steel AISI 304
- connection 3/4" - DN16
- the transparent container allows monitoring the condition of the neutralising filling
- designed for discharging condensate into the sewer drain
- the service life of the filling depends on the pH and quantity of condensate
